How to make it

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9x13 inch baking pan.
  • In a saucepan over medium heat, melt the caramels with the evaporated milk, stirring frequently until smooth. Set aside.
  • In a medium bowl, stir together the flour, oats, brown sugar, baking soda, and salt. Stir in the melted butter. Press half of the mixture into the bottom of the prepared pan.
  • Bake for 10 minutes in the preheated oven. Remove from the oven, and sprinkle the crust with chocolate chips and walnuts. Drizzle the caramel mixture over all. Crumble the remaining oat mixture evenly over the top, and pat down lightly.
  • Bake for an additional 15 to 20 minutes, or until the top is golden. Cool before cutting into bars.
